ICT Cabinet Secretary Mr. Joe Mucheru has appointed four members to the board of the Communications Authority of Kenya (CA) in a Gazette notice issued on Friday, July 26, 2019.
In the notice, Mr.Mucheru appointed Mr. Mahmoud Mohamed Noor, Mr. Paul Muraguri Mureithi, Ms. Laura Chite and Mr. Jackson Kiprotich Kemboi to the CA board adding that the new members will help the board address issues such as competition and dominance in the telco sector, support innovation and ensure the right regulations are in place.
CS Mucheru also added that the government has no role in appointing or influencing the next Safaricom CEO even though the government is a shareholder. He also added the issue of the split of Safaricom is an internal affair and not the government’s.
According to the Kenya Information and Communications Act 1998, the CA board comprises a chairman appointed by the President, seven members appointed by the Cabinet Secretary, Ministry of ICT, and Principal Secretaries from Ministries of ICT, the National Treasury and that of Interior and Coordination of National Government.
The four will serve for a three-year term effective 18th July 2019. Established in 1999, the CA is the regulatory authority for the communications sector in Kenya.
Established by the Kenya Information and Communications Act, 1998, the Authority is responsible for facilitating the development of the information and communications sectors including; broadcasting, cybersecurity, multimedia, telecommunications, electronic commerce, postal and courier services.
